We are moving to Oz on 3rd May, and having a 5 week travelling holiday before we hope to settle in Sydney.

We are flying with Singapore Airlines, and are going to take advantage of the 40K baggage allowance, but we don't want to drag 2 large suitcases round Oz with us, so intend to leave them with some family we have in Perth.

Does anyone know the cheapest way to then get the cases sent to us in Sydney, as I have had a quote from DHL for $553 PER CASE!

There are a few companies

Just doing a quick quote on sevenseas for 2 boxes from Perth to Sydney it comes up at $298. They have the option to put in suitcases... but I didn’t know you’re size and you can probably find cheaper than the $298. (I’ve heard grayhound Australia do great shipping rates)

Edit: put it in for a quick quote in e-go.com.au, and if you choose the economy transport of a pallet weighing less than 1000kg, Perth CBD to Sydney CBD by truck would cost...$66. Pallets aren't hard to come by but in any case I am sure that loose cases wouldn't be that much more. Make sure to wrap up/disguise well and insure, though.
